Some 40 to 50 works of art, including original paintings, prints, sculpture and jewelry pieces, will be auctioned next Sunday, March 10, during an "Art for Life" fund-raising benefit being held at the Tivoli Gallery, 225 S. State St., for the Utah AIDS Foundation.
The event will begin at 1:30 p.m. and continue througout the afternoon and early evening. The program will include a variety of performing and visual arts.Artworks have been donated by several well-known local and regional artists.
Music will be provided by Gregory Saint-Thomas, local pianist-composer (whose sculpture, jewelry and artwork will be included in the auctions), and by Mark Chambers' "Completely Gershwin" cabaret revue performers.
Light refreshments will also be served.
Admission is $35 per couple, with proceeds from both the ticket sales and auctions going to the Utah AIDS Foundation. Tickets will be available at the door or can be purchased in advance by calling the foundation at 359-5555.
